Sourcing guidance for Hematology Analyzer Diluent

What are the key technical specifications to consider when selecting a Hematology Analyzer Diluent?

When sourcing diluents, the most critical factor is chemical compatibility with the specific analyzer brand (e.g., Mindray, Sysmex, Beckman Coulter). Key specs include pH stability (typically 7.0-7.4), osmolarity levels to prevent cell shrinkage or bursting, and conductivity for accurate impedance counting. Ensure the reagent has a background count of ≤0.1 x 10^9/L for WBC and ≤10 x 10^9/L for PLT to avoid interference with patient results.

What compliance standards and certifications are mandatory for international procurement?

As a medical IVD (In Vitro Diagnostic) product, the supplier must possess ISO 13485 certification for medical device quality management. For specific markets, ensure the product has CE marking (IVDR compliance) for Europe or FDA 510(k) clearance for the US. Additionally, a Certificate of Analysis (CoA) and Material Safety Data Sheet (MSDS) must accompany every batch to verify chemical safety and performance benchmarks.

How does the quality of the diluent affect the lifespan of the hematology analyzer?

High-quality diluents contain anti-fungal and anti-bacterial agents that prevent biofilm buildup in the fluidic pathways. Using sub-standard reagents can lead to clogging of the ruby aperture, corrosion of internal valves, and frequent calibration errors. Prioritize suppliers that offer high-purity, filtered solutions (0.2μm filtration) to minimize maintenance costs and downtime.

What are the storage and shelf-life requirements for bulk purchasing?

Standard diluents typically have a shelf life of 12 to 24 months. They must be stored in a cool, dry place (2°C to 30°C) away from direct sunlight. For cross-border shipping, verify that the packaging is UV-resistant and leak-proof. Once opened, the 'on-board' stability usually ranges from 30 to 60 days, so calculate your purchase volume based on your laboratory's daily throughput to avoid waste.

Cross-Border Procurement Strategy for IVD Reagents

What are the primary risks when importing medical reagents like diluents?

The biggest risks are temperature excursions during transit and customs clearance delays due to missing medical registrations. To mitigate this, use temperature-monitored shipping containers and ensure the supplier provides a Declaration of Conformity. Always verify if your local Ministry of Health requires an Import License for IVD reagents before placing a bulk order.

What negotiation strategies work best for long-term reagent supply?

Since diluents are consumables, negotiate based on annual volume commitment rather than a single order to secure discounts of 20-40%. Ask for free samples (2-5L) to conduct a parallel study against the original equipment manufacturer (OEM) reagents. Additionally, negotiate for replacement guarantees if the reagent fails to meet background count standards upon arrival.

What is the most cost-effective shipping method for heavy liquid reagents?

Diluents are heavy and relatively low-value per kilogram, making Sea Freight (LCL or FCL) the most economical choice. For urgent needs, Air Freight is possible but expensive due to liquid handling surcharges. Ensure the supplier uses palletized packaging with reinforced shrink-wrap to prevent leakage and facilitate easy unloading at the destination port.
